Transaction 2e486d5d6e1127bcd293a3fdcf0040d749ab42be28a3649b09ffb5e7839fdceb

70 Input
1 Outputs
  • 2e486d5d6e1127bcd293a3fdcf0040d749ab42be28a3649b09ffb5e7839fdceb:0
  • value  22750146
    address  3L9qAGBQLbXkFAB2GpijnJXPScSVjuiJio